Post Doctoral Associate - Production and Farm Management

RESPONSIBILITIES:  This appointment is 100% research in production and farm management with emphasis on production economics and farm management.  The candidate will work with departmental faculties, as well as Dr. Bob Taylor, Auburn University, on research relating to the economics of peanut production.  Major focuses will be to assemble a cost-of-production database, evaluate peanut production efficiency using relevant econometric and/or math programming analyses, develop representative peanut farms for the southeastern states, whole-farm modeling, and publication of results.  The position is grant funded for a period of twenty-four (24) months with possible continuation. 

QUALIFICATIONS:  A Ph.D. (awarded and/or certification of all requirements completed) in Agricultural Economics, Economics, Business, or related field.

Post Doctoral Associate - Agricultural Risk Management
GENERAL NATURE:   Post Doctoral Associate.  Full-time(100% research), non-tenure track position.  Employment will be for a period of 18 months.
CLOSING DATE:  To be fully considered, applications must be received by December 15, 2001.

 Job Duties:
 
 
 

 

A research position focusing on agricultural risk management.  Primary responsibilities relate to a federally funded research project that will examine the feasibility of managing yield risk on selected agricultural commodities and in selected regions using weather-based (precipitation, temperature, etc.) insurance products.
 Qualifications:

 

Ph.D. in agricultural economics, economics, finance or a related field.  Knowledge of crop insurance and other agricultural risk management tools is desirable but not required.  Strong quantitative and data management skills are necessary.
